Subject: Triathlon or road bike? 650 or 700c wheels
Hi there. I will enter my first ironman this summer (covid permitting). I currently ride a road bike with 650b wheels. i am wondering about a TT bike. i am 152cm with a 70cm inseam. is there a fast bike out there for me? Does anyone have a recommendation?

Subject: RE: Triathlon or road bike? 650 or 700c wheels

152 cm = 5’0” (a bit less) and 70 cm = 27-28” for those not conversant in metric.

650b tires are 23 mm wide and 100 psi (0.689 MPa)?

if my tire assumption is correct, you’ve already got something that will work and given your size, finding a tri bike may be quite challenging.  Very doubtful you’ll fit on anything with 700c wheels well.  i got ~1mph increase (17 to 18 mph ) going to an aero position, most of which you could get with clip on aero bars.  One thing you might consider if you haven’t already is getting shorter crank arms.  You give up a little mechanical advantage, but you may fit better pedaling around a smaller circle.
